Perham improved their season record to 6-0 with a 67-40 win over Sauk Centre on Wednesday at the Perham Holiday Basketball Tournament. The Yellowjackets built a 30-16 halftime record and won the second half 37-24. Perham shot 54.5% (24-44) from the field and made 55% (11-20) of their three-pointers.
Soren Anderson led four players in double digits, scoring 20 points. He also had 7 rebounds and 3 assists. Micah Thompson contributed 13 points, 6 rebounds and 2 assists, Alex Ohm had 12 points, 9 assists, 3 steals and 5 rebounds) and Jacob Daniels ended up with 12 points and 4 boards. Evan Kovash secured 7 rebounds to go along with 5 points.
Sauk Centre was led by Jay Neubert’s 18 points. Andrew Drevlow added 8 points. The Mainstreeters made just 33% (16-49) of their shots from the floor.
Perham will host Detroit Lakes on Tuesday, January 3.
